When a Nakshatra occurs twice in a month, sometimes either the first or the second occurrence may coincide with the beginning of a new month (Masapirappu) or a day designated for Tarpanam. This coincidence constitutes Sankaramana Dosha. If it falls on a day when Tarpanam is to be performed, the birthday should not be celebrated on that day. For example, if an eclipse (Grahana) occurs on one of the two days, then one should celebrate the birthday on the Nakshatra day that is free from the eclipse.
